Output 8704468434cacc5fc839946480d20e25723726eb46508134d27c0e4bdee9e02b:5

value
171520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f512e0dd5a2f94a0240692bf9fda25caeef952 OP_EQUAL
address
2NAqVK8wDidvucwoeTJGpwsiDsxizMtp1j2
transaction
8704468434cacc5fc839946480d20e25723726eb46508134d27c0e4bdee9e02b